Given below are two statements :
Statement (I) : The first ionization energy of Pb is greater than that of Sn .
Statement (II) : The first ionization energy of Ge is greater than that of Si .
In the light of the above statements, choose the correct answer from the options given below :
Solution
<p>Order of I.E. (in KJ/mol) :</p>
<p>$$\matrix{
C & > & {Si} & > & {Ge} & > & {Sn} & > & {Pb} \cr
{1086} & {} & {786} & {} & {761} & {} & {708} & {} & {715} \cr
}$$</p>
